Broker's Comments
This boat has hardly been used since new and it shows. The boat is kept in a garage and is in beautiful condition. The mast and boom are made from Douglas Fir and the topsides are made from varnished Mahogany which really sets her off.
The Tideway is a boat for fun with the family but and has a performance which will get you home against the wind and tide of an estuary river or one which will let you sail or race (she has a RYA Handicap Number) with the Classic Dayboats.
The roomy and safe open layout – Tideways are boats you sit in and not on - and the high boom gives comfort and confidence, allows easy boarding and enables the crew to move safely round the boat.
She can be sailed single-handed or with a crew and she can be rowed either from the bow (with the mast down) or amidships. The rig is practical and manageable with mainsail reefing as standard.
This example has both the Combi road and launch trailer and a spare wheel.
